Water Heater Burst Cleanup Cost In Riverdale, UT
The cost of Water Heater Burst Cleanup in Riverdale,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of mold or bacteria growth, size of affected area |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Complexity of repairs, size of affected area |
| Final inspection and verification | $500 – $2,000 | Complexity of inspection, size of affected area |

What causes a water heater to burst?
A water heater can burst due to a variety of reasons, including corrosion, mineral buildup, or manufacturing defects. Our team can help diagnose the issue and provide expert repair or replacement services.
How long does Water Heater Burst Cleanup take?
The length of time it takes to complete Water Heater Burst Cleanup service can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average, it can take anywhere from a few hours to several days to complete the job.
